6 Master's degrees in Classics in Florida, United States
Classics - Ancient History
The program in Classics - Ancient History at Florida State University offers students a historical focus, while also emphasizing a strong foundation in the methods and materials of the Classical world.
Latin
The Department of Classics at the University of Florida offers an M.A. degree in Latin, an M.A.T. degree in Latin, as well as a Master of Latin degree. Students are expected to become Florida residents after one year.
Classics - Classical Archaeology
The M.A. in Classics - Classical Archaeology at Florida State Universityoffers students the opportunity to focus their coursework in the archaeology and art history of the ancient Mediterranean world.
Classics - Greek and Latin
The M.A. in Classics - Greek and Latin at Florida State University allows students to focus on coursework in Greek and Latin literature.
Classical Studies
The M.A. degree in Classical Studies at University of Florida is an interdisciplinary major, with specializations in ancient language and classical civilization that offer students instruction in the history, literature, and culture of the ancient Greeks and Romans.
Classics - Greek
The M.A. in Classics - Greek at Florida State University allows students to focus on coursework in Greek literature and culture. It is suited for those who intend to pursue further work in Classics at the Ph.D. level.
